Patent number: 11760913Abstract: A drilling fluid containing a liquid phase, a weighting agent (e.g. barite, calcite, ilmenite), and perlite is described. The drilling fluid may further contain one or more additives including a defoamer, a fluid-loss control agent, a viscosifier, an antiscalant, a deflocculant, a lubricant, a clay stabilizer, a bridging agent, and a surfactant. A process of drilling a subterranean geological formation utilizing the drilling fluid is also specified. The introduction of perlite to the drilling fluid is effective in reducing the thickness and permeability of filter cakes formed during the drilling process.Type: GrantFiled: June 14, 2019Date of Patent: September 19, 2023Assignee: King Fahd University of Petroleum and MineralsInventors: Badr Salem Ba Geri, Abdulrauf Adebayo, Jaber Al Jaberi, Shirish Patil

Patent number: 10883038Abstract: A barite filter cake removing composition, and single- and multi-stage methods of removing a barite filter cake from a wellbore. The composition comprises at least one polymer removal agent, at least one chelating agent, and at least one converting agent. The single-stage method includes contacting the barite filter cake with the composition to dissolve the barite filter cake from the wellbore. The multi-stage method includes contacting the barite filter cake from the wellbore with at least one polymer removal agent to remove a polymer coat present on the barite filter cake, contacting the barite filter cake with at least one converting agent to convert barium sulfate in the barite filter cake to a barium salt of carbonate, formate, cyanide, nitrate, and/or chloride, and removing the barium salt of carbonate, formate, cyanide, nitrate, and/or chloride with at least one chelating agent.Type: GrantFiled: March 11, 2019Date of Patent: January 5, 2021Assignee: KING FAHD UNIVERSITY OF PETROLEUM AND MINERALSInventors: Badr Salem Ba Geri, Mohamed Ahmed Mahmoud, Abdulazeez Abdulraheem, Reyad Awwad Shawabkeh

Patent number: 10323173Abstract: A method of removing an iron sulfide scale from a surface in fluid communication with a wellbore and/or subterranean formation comprising contacting the iron sulfide scale on the surface with a composition to dissolve the iron sulfide scale in the composition. The composition comprises (a) at least one chelating agent selected from the group consisting of DTPA, EDTA HEDTA, GLDA, CDTA, and MGDA, and salts thereof, and (b) at least one converting agent selected from the group consisting of potassium carbonate (K2CO3), potassium formate (HCOOK), potassium hydroxide (KOH), potassium chloride (KCl), cesium formate (HCOOCs), and cesium chloride (CsCl). In the composition, the weight ratio of (a):(b) lies in the range 7-60:2-20.Type: GrantFiled: September 7, 2017Date of Patent: June 18, 2019Assignee: King Fahd University of Petroleum and MineralsInventors: Mohamed Ahmed Nasreldin Mahmoud, Badr Salem Ba Geri, Ibnelwaleed A. Hussein

Patent number: 9856410Abstract: A drilling fluid system using retarded acid systems such as gelled acid (VES or polymer) and/or emulsified acid to drill carbonate formations (calcite and dolomite). Foamed acid may be used in low abnormal pressure carbonate reservoirs. The drilling fluid system permits drilling a target hydrocarbon-producing formation with zero-invasion of the drilling fluid system. A method for using the drilling fluid system for fluid loss control during drilling operations.Type: GrantFiled: April 14, 2017Date of Patent: January 2, 2018Assignee: King Fahd University of Petroleum and MineralsInventors: Badr Salem Ba Geri, Mohamed Ahmed Mahmoud
